After Brayan Daniel is fired from his job and falsely accused by neighbors of being an accomplice to local robberies within their condominium, he finds himself in a desperate situation. Toña, always practical and sharp-tongued, suggests a radical career pivot: joining the Police Academy.

"Oríllese a la Orilla" is a Mexican comedy series produced by TelevisaUnivision for its streaming platform, ViX. It serves as a "spin-off" or continuation for the beloved characters, Toña and Brayan, who were fan favorites in the original series "40 y 20".
The phrase "Oríllese a la orilla" translates roughly to "pull over to the side of the road," a classic command used by traffic police in Mexico—teasing the exact direction this comedic duo is headed.
